x14156October 17 was the birthday of Elinor Glyn, sensational writer of clit lit in the early 20th century…She coined the term “it girl” and pioneered bonkbuster fiction…Had seriously scandalous & interesting personal life AND did bloody well for herself…Her Mercury (always the first thing to look at with such successful writers and cultural stirrers) was opposite Neptune…She had a fantastic Grand Air Trine involving: Midheaven in Aquarius trine Sun-Saturn in Libra and Uranus in Gemini…Total sense for someone so unconventional and yet break-thru.

Venus was conjunct Jupiter and the North Node in Scorpio/the 6th house – really apt for a woman who made her fortune by working hard her whole life long about sex & love + expanding the societal possibilities.

If I had not whizzed to Wikipedia to check Pepe Le Pew’s birth details (for a cartoon character, it is always their first appearance in media & it’s sooo accurate) I would  not have known that Johnny Depp drew upon the French skunk for his portrayal of Captain Jack Sparrow in Pirates of the Caribbean.  Hmm.

Anyway, Pepe is known for falling inappropriately (ie; inter-species) in love and making grand gestures that are utterly at odds with the actual reality of the “relationship” in play. I mean, he is a Skunk. But he sees himself as a grand seducer in the classic tradition.

The astro, of course, fits.  Get this. He is a Capricorn (ambitious, aspires to the high life and trophy partner) and his Moon is  in Libra with Venus in Pisces. So the latter two means he is a natural romantic as well. It’s not just cynical chasing down of a “catch.” Venus in Pisces sextiles Mars in Capricorn so there’s a libido throbbing away there as well BUT the aspects I love of Pepe Le Pew’s are:

* Venus in Pisces Squares Uranus in Gemini – He’s a bit perverse & kinky. He is maybe not so mistaken after all when he goes after cats instead of skunks, his own species.

* Mercury in Saggitarius squares Jupiter in Virgo – This is such a good expression of those grandiose gestures & insane serenades he indulges in. His need for candour is hyped by O.T.T. Jupiter & the Virgoan discrimination is swamped by an overblown Mercury in Sagg.

* Moon conjunct Neptune – the perpetual dreamer. He may have extremely lucid & sensual dreams that break into his everyday reality.

He needs a very creatively fulfilling and involved job so that the fantasy element of his life can be worked out positively rather than by stalking uninterested cats and attempting to hide his true nature with copious amounts of scent.
